PBFB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review
12 of the 7,598 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in PGIM US Large-Cap Buffer 20 ETF February (PBFB)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$9.97M — up 19% from $8.36M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 3 funds opened new PBFB positions and 1 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 1 added to existing stakes and 2 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Prudential Financial, adding an estimated $1.1M. The largest seller was Old Mission Capital, exiting entirely with an estimated $420K sold.
